Sr Qa Analyst Resume
Torrance, CA
SUMMARY
- Over 7 years of QA experience in Manual as well as Automated Testing on Mainframe, Web and Client - Server applications
- Worked extensively on Mercury Interactive Testing Tools - Load Runner, Win Runner, QuickTestPro (QTP), Quality Center and Test Director (TD)
- Expertise in QA Methodologies, Quality Assurance Life Cycle (QALC), Test strategy, Test metrics, Software Development Life Cycle (SDLC) and CMM.
- Strong in Requirements Gathering and Analyzing Business specifications.
- Performed System, Functional, Performance/Load, Compatibility, Regression, Integration, Positive, Negative, White Box Testing, Black Box, Performance Testing, Load Testing and Stress Testing.
- Created automated Test scripts using QTP, Win Runner and Rational Robot.
- Used SQL queries to interact with databases Oracle9i, DB2 and SQL Server2005.
- Extensively involved in using Quality Centre, Test Director, Rational Clear Quest to report bug.
- Knowledge in all stages of the Software Development Life Cycle (SDLC). Experience in project management methodologies(Agile and Scrum)
- Experience in Testing Enterprise wide applications on Diverse Platforms also experience in troubleshooting Windows Server and desktop based systems.
- Experience in User Acceptance Testing (UAT).
- Involved in preparation of Test Data and managing data requests.
- Participated in meetings, walkthroughs and interacted with the development team in order to improve testing quality.
- Experience in bug reporting and bug tracking using defect tracking tools like Quality Center, Clear Quest.
- Managed team of ten testers, Vast Experience in onsite and offshore Model.
- Excellent interpersonal skills and a good Team Lead and Team player
- Excellent leadership qualities and communication (oral, written, presentation) skills
TECHNICAL SKILLS
Operating System: Windows Vista/XP /2000 /NT /98
Testing Tools: Load Runner8.1/7.0, QTP9.2/8.2/6.5, Win Runner 7.6/7.0,Rational Robot
Test Mgt. Tools: TestDirector7.0,Quality Center8.2,Rational Manager, Clear Quest
Front - End Tools: PeopleSoft HRMS,Informatica,Cognos 8 BI, VB,VSS, Business Objects6.5
Languages: C,C++, C#,Java, VB.NET,ASP.NET,SQL
Web Tech: HTML,UML,VBScript,JavaScript, Web Services,(SOA) and SOAP
Database: MS Access, Oracle9i/11i,DB2,SQL Server2000/2005
PROFESSIONAL EXPERIENCE
Sr QA Analyst
Confidential, Torrance, CA
Responsibilities:
- Prepared Test plan and Test specifications based on Functional Requirement Specifications and System Design Specifications.
- Developed Test cases based on the technical specifications and business requirements.
- Used Mercury Quality Center to write test cases.
- Executed SQL statements to check the database.
- Extensively involved in manual testing of the Application.
- Performed Regression testing for every modification in the application & new builds using QTP.
- Developed automated Test Scripts using QTP.
- Wrote various SQL Queries as a part of backend testing.
- Reported software defects and interacted with the developers to resolve the defects investigated in the application during testing.
- Responsible in Creating & Updating the Documentations related to its Architecture and its Releases.
- Using Load Runner Monitors for CPU performance, Memory Usage, Paging etc on various servers associated with the application during the test execution time.
- Participated in Meetings from analysis phase to till UAT.
- Responsible for creating the System Performance Graph from the results of the incremental (user load) stress tests.
- The management used this System Performance Graph to determine the scalability of the system, response time at the desired throughput and the system break point (knee of the curve).
- Involved in entire testing process including Functional testing, Integration, Regression testing and User acceptance testing.
- Communicated with Client in understanding the requirements and Change request.
- Generated status reports and Bug reports and presented them in weekly status meetings.
- Participated in scheduled meetings and maintained good relationship with developer community.
Environment: Manual Testing, Automation with QTP 8.2, Load Runner, Quality Center, SQL, Java, Windows 2000, Oracle 10g.
Sr QA Analyst
Confidential, Columbus, OH
Responsibilities:
- Worked in Agile test driven development environment, involving in all the phases of design, development, testing and presentation of each scrum release tasks to business users.
- Involved in Functional, Integration, Regression, User Acceptance (UAT) Testing.
- Performed Functional and Regression Testing using WinRunner and its several features including synchronization points, check points, functions and parameterized scripts.
- Designed SQL queriesforTestingand Report Generation according to the provided specifications.
- Simple to complex techniques are used in designing these queries including but not limited to Joins (inner and outer), sub-queries, correlated queries and inbuilt database functions.
- Prepared Test Reports and submitted the Bug Findings to the Bug Tracking system using Test Director and its modules (Requirements, Test Plan, Test lab and Defects).
- Involved in documenting the test cases and test results and provided the management with Test and performance reports.
- Also participated in design walkthroughs and meetings with other members and management.
- Worked closely with Software Development Team in synchronizing our efforts towards a better product by providing them with documented feedback on the User Interface, product functionality and was also actively involved with technical architects in discussing further developments in system design.
- Worked closely with web team and database team for production releases and with business users in Production support of the application.
- Worked on Performance tuning issues identified during testing.
Environment: Manual Testing, Automation with QTP 8.2, Load Runner, Quality Center.
QA Analyst
Confidential, Dallas, TX
Responsibilities:
- Reviewing Business Requirement Documents and the Technical Specification Setup a QA process and ensured it was effective project wide.
- Documented test cases corresponding to business rules and other operating conditions.
- Administered & Developed Test Scripts and scenarios that reflect user needs for the functional, User Interface, Performance, Usability and Security requirements.
- Documented the rejected data and backtracked the issue.
- Extensively wrote SQL queries in TOAD to validate the data that is being sent from source to target tables.
- Worked with other QA teams to integrate the complete business process and to get the flat files or required data from them.
- Tested Data Conversions on huge data transfers from various source applications to target databases
- Created Test input Data Requirements and prepared the test data for data driven testing.
- Created and executed Test scripts to verify complex system requirements.
- Worked in an agile environment.
- Interacted with developers to explain software bugs when required, and re-tested the fixed issues.
- Used Rational Clear Quest for defect management.
- Created and Maintained Regression Test Scripts for overall business process and executing them in QA Environment as well as Production Environment.
- Worked closely with developers while performing unit testing.
- Updated Summary Report daily on Test Logs defects/issues and followed up with defect review meetings as necessary.
- Reviewed the functional and operational specifications and prepared work plans for System testing.
Environment: Java, SQL, Quick Test Professional 9.2, Quality Centre 9.0(Test Director), TOAD, Windows XP.
QA Analyst
Confidential
Responsibilities:
- Prepared Test plan and Test specifications based on Functional Requirement Specifications and System Design Specifications.
- Developed Test cases based on the technical specifications and business requirements.
- Used Mercury Quality Center to write test cases.
- Converted all manual test cases into QTPro automated scripts.
- Executed test scripts using Quality Center and analyzed the test results.
- Designed QTPro automation scripts, parameterized them, and validated them to suit the functionality of the application.
- Modified QT Pro scripts in expert mode and various user-defined functions.
- Developed test cases and test scripts using Automated Tools for Functionality, Security and Regression Testing.
- Maintained the requirements traceability matrix and reviewed frequently to ensure that test cases appropriately translated and mapped to requirements.
- Extensively worked Load Runner in analyzing LCP application performance for varying Loads and Stress conditions.
- Measured the response time at different points in the application using Load Runner
- Planned and created the Virtual user scripts and enhanced them with Transactions, Rendezvous points, Functions, Parameterization and Correlation.
- Used Quality Center for requirement analysis, scheduling and generating test cases
- Developed automated Scripts using Load Runner 9.0 for various Business processes once the environment was stable.
- Re-executed the Tests for the corresponding volumes and made sure that the parameters are within the acceptable limits after the fixes are done by the environment support team.
- Prioritized and classified bugs. Generated and tracked the defects using Quality Center
- Tested the application compatibility with IE 6/7, Fire Fox 2.0, and Safari browsers on different operation systems Vista, XP.
Environment: QTP 9.0, Quality Center 9.0, Load Runner 9.0,Java, J2EE,JSP,Oracle,Windows XP/Vista
QA Analyst
Confidential, Lake Forest, CA
Responsibilities:
- Designed and Analyzed Test case design document basing on the Functional Requirement Specifications to implement thorough testing process.
- Analyzed and Developing Test Plan, Test Cases, Test Scripts, Expected Test Results and Test Procedure from functional requirement for each module.
- Involved in GUI, Business Testing, Functionality Testing, Manual testing, White Box testing, Black box Testing, System testing, including Integration, Performance, Stress, Load and Regression Testing of Web and Client/Server based applications and UAT using Automated Testing tools like QTP, Load runner, Win runner and Quality Center (Test Director)
- Scripted test suites in Quick Test Professional 9.0, including custom functions in VBScript, to regression test daily build and stored them in Quality Center 9.0 for execution and maintenance purpose.
- Used MercuryQualityCenter 9.0 to check out the latest versions of the build for testing purposes, and check in the updated test cases, and test documentation periodically.
- Maintained bug lists for critical issues using MercuryQualityCenter 9.0.
- Participated in status meetings to report issues. Communicated with developers through all phases of testing to prioritize bug resolution using Quality Center.
- Creation and Execution of Test Scripts using Quick Test Professional (QTP 9.1) and analyze results including black box and regression testing with the Mercury Quality Center 9.0.
- Written VB scripts for various Quick Test Professional test cases.
- Conducted extensive Security Testing including alternative user identification and authentication using manual testing as well as using Smart Object Identification with automatic tool Quick Test Professional 9.1.
- Prepared a comprehensive Database Testing Summary Report for the application with extended coverage of all Backend Tests performed on AUT and came up with conclusions and recommendations
- Performed back-end testing by extensively using SQL commands to verify the database integrity.
- Evaluated test results to identify performance issues, bottlenecks.
- Maintained baseline metrics for each application, component, and release.
- Planned, designed, executed and evaluated performance tests of web application and services and ensured optimal application performance using Load Runner.
- Identified performance issues with the servers and made recommendations for their performance improvement.
- Report and track issues using bug tracking system and verify solutions.
- Involved in Logging, recording, issues, tracking and maintaining the defects using Bugzilla.
- Generated the reports using Bugzilla on daily basis.
Environment: .NET,Oracle,Quick Test Professional 9.2, Quality Centre 9.0,TOAD,Windows XP,Load Runner 8.0, Win runner, Bugzilla, Crystal reports.
QA Tester
Confidential, Denver, CO
Responsibilities:
- Prepared Test plan and Test specifications based on Functional Requirement Specifications and System Design Specifications.
- Developed Test cases based on the technical specifications and business requirements.
- Used Mercury Quality Center to write test cases.
- Executed SQL statements to check the database.
- Responsible in running Unix Shell Scripts for different server process.
- Extensively involved in manual testing of the Application.
- Performed Regression testing for every modification in the application & new builds using QTP.
- Developed automated Test Scripts using QTP.
- Wrote various SQL Queries as a part of backend testing.
- Reported software defects and interacted with the developers to resolve the defects investigated in the application during testing.
- Responsible in Creating & Updating the Documentations related to its Architecture and its Releases.
- Using Load Runner Monitors forCPU performance, Memory Usage, Paging etc on various servers associated with the application during the test execution time.
- Participated in Meetings from analysis phase to till UAT.
- Responsible for creating the System Performance Graph from the results of the incremental (user load) stress tests.
- The management used this System Performance Graph to determine the scalability of the system, response time at the desired throughput and the system break point (knee of the curve).
- Involved in entire testing process including Functional testing, Integration, Regression testing and User acceptance testing.
- Communicated with Client in understanding the requirements and Change request.
- Generated status reports and Bug reports and presented them in weekly status meetings.
Environment: Manual Testing, Automation with QTP 8.2, Load Runner, Quality Center, SQL, Java, Windows 2000, Oracle 10g
QA Tester
Confidential
Responsibilities:
- Analyzed business requirements, system requirement specifications and responsible for documenting.
- Functional requirements and supplementary requirements in Test Director.
- Ran Smoke test every morning after each build.
- Performed Functionality, Regression and User Acceptance Testing.
- Performed Black box testing for the application and reported the defects using Test Director.
- Written positive, negative test case and conducted tests as needed.
- Performed unit testing using JUnit test cases to test the behavior of the coded classes.
- Developed automated test scripts using Quick Test Pro to perform functional and regression testing.
- Used Quick test pro data table to parameterize the tests.
- Created Test input requirements and prepared the test data for data driven testing.
- Carried out extensive testing with the QTP testing tool with different test cases, which reflects the various real time business situations.
- Performed actual load and stress testing using Load Runner by creating virtual users and multiple Scenarios.
- Performed load and stress testing using rendezvous points and recording transactions in LoadRunner,to pinpoint potential problem areas and bottlenecks.
- Created Check points and Synchronization points for functional testing using Quick Test Pro.
- Data validation and Database integrity testing done by executing SQL statements.
- Release of the components on Acceptance and Production Environment after testing and finalinspection.
Environment: Oracle 9i, SQL, Test Director, TOAD, QTP, QC
